Kids these days have it easy. I mean it. They really do. I’m not talking about those fables we have all heard from our parents about walking 37 miles to school with out shoes, uphill in both directions. 13 below with 4 foot snow drifts in the morning, 121 degrees by the time they were walking home. I’m talking about real stuff.
Take for example when I was a child. Watching TV, on a box, where you had to walk up and actually turn the channels between the 5 channels you did get. Even the commercials pressured you. The Indian that cried because someone threw away a piece of paper was always a checkpoint, but the one that really got me was Smokey the Bear…you know what I’m talking about. “Only YOU can provide forest fires.” Did they even consider how that would affect me?
I was 8 years old when I saw that commercial the first time. “Me? Only me? Good thing I was watching TV today! They should have sent a letter or something” (email was not available unless you were a close personal friend of Al Gore). I’m 8 years old and they expect me to not only come up with a plan, but implement it, too? And seriously, you can’t do it alone!
Did you know there are 132 forest currently recognized in the United States alone? Now, I don’t know about you, but I couldn’t see ANY of them from my bedroom window, and I obviously couldn’t go around and check each forest a couple of times a night. So, you try and network. Do you have any idea how many times a person will take a call in the middle of the night from an 8 year old asking, “is the forest on fire” before they are using grown up words to you? Take it from me, 1.5 times….unless she thinks like you sound like her grandson Bradley, then good luck getting her to let you off the phone so you can call the next person. And don’t even get me started on explaining the phone bill to my parents for 264 long distance calls a night….or being on a first name basis with various fire departments.
I don’t know…I just think that they could have at least split up the work load a little bit. But no…..Only I could prevent forest fires. I always figured word had gotten out on my fire prevention merit badge.
I did notice though that the ads dropped way off for many years, so I figured my work must have been pretty good. But now I am seeing the ads again….would it really hurt if they just communicated a little bit? If I am not doing a satisfactory job any longer, couldn’t they just pick up the phone and let me know? It kind of hurts to find out I’ve been fired on TV.
But like I say, kids these days really have it easy. For the new kid taking over my spot, you have the internet. Now, with a couple of clicks, you can check a web cam, another click you are notifying the proper departments, and you can be back in bed 20 minutes later. No more calling Mr. Peterson who not only had very colorful language, but also the only home that looked over the entire Beaverhead-Deerlodge National Forest. And certainly no more 2 hour conversations at 4 in the morning trying to convince someone you’re not Bradley.
